Solar PV tiles – explaining the pros and cons

You may have heard about solar PV tiles but it’s important to understand the benefits, especially if you’re considering incorporating them into your roof. Solar tiles do tend to be more expensive than solar panels, and that’s mainly because they’re more expensive to make. These tiles work together to offer a good level of home energy, but they do look like ordinary tiles. Many people will not completely cover their entire roof with these durable solar PV tiles, and instead they will incorporate them into their existing tiles, whether they’re slate, clay or metal. These tiles can be designed to match your existing tiles but solar panels could prove to be wiser investment if you’re not too fussed about roof styling. Maintaining your Roof by Removing Moss

Moss can be clear to see on many aged roofs, and if you want to keep yours in excellent condition then it’s important to remove moss when a great deal of it is found on your roof. Moss thickens over time and it can actually lift up tiles on your roof, allowing dampness to seep through. A great deal of moss can also build up water levels and you may then find that you’re guttering system is not entirely useful because the water remains lodged in certain areas. It’s important to make sure you remove moss properly, not by pressure washing which can actually do damage to your roof.
